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.
Bug 359784 - Contribution of Jetty implementation of JAXWS 2.2 HTTP SPI
Summary: Contribution of Jetty implementation of JAXWS 2.2 HTTP SPI
Status: CLOSED WONTFIX
Alias: None
Product: Jetty
Classification: RT
Component: server (show other bugs)
Version: unspecified   Edit
Hardware: PC Windows 7
: P3 enhancement (vote)
Target Milestone: 7.5.x   Edit
Assignee: Jesse McConnell CLA
QA Contact:
URL:
Whiteboard:
Keywords:
Depends on: 323453
Blocks:
  Show dependency tree
 
Reported: 2011-10-03 23:49 EDT by Aaron Anderson CLA
Modified: 2012-12-14 16:36 EST (History)
2 users (show)

See Also:


Attachments
Contributed code (80.20 KB, application/zip)
2011-10-03 23:50 EDT, Aaron Anderson CLA
no flags Details

Note You need to log in before you can comment on or make changes to this bug.
Description Aaron Anderson CLA 2011-10-03 23:49:24 EDT
Build Identifier: 

I would like to contribute the attached code to the Jetty project. I wrote all of the attached code personally and I release all rights to it.

Reproducible: Didn't try

Steps to Reproduce:
N/A
Comment 1 Aaron Anderson CLA 2011-10-03 23:50:42 EDT
Created attachment 204483 [details]
Contributed code
Comment 2 Jesse McConnell CLA 2011-10-04 11:35:59 EDT
great Aaron!  I'll start the CQ for this shortly :)
Comment 3 Jesse McConnell CLA 2011-10-05 13:17:00 EDT
CQ5681
Comment 4 Jesse McConnell CLA 2012-01-10 17:38:48 EST
ok, while this is approved, I don't know that I'll actually be able to bring this in anymore...

originally I had thought this was going to have synergy with the existing jetty-http-spi module but they work off of completely different underlying dependencies.  To do this I would have to open CQ's for all these dependencies below (which admittedly we already have 2) and babysit them through the CQ process, and then transform them into osgi bundles and get them shepparded through orbit and I am just not feeling the love for getting all that done.

[DEBUG]    javax.xml.ws:jaxws-api:jar:2.2.8:provided
[DEBUG]       javax.xml.bind:jaxb-api:jar:2.2.4:provided
[DEBUG]          javax.xml.stream:stax-api:jar:1.0-2:provided
[DEBUG]          javax.activation:activation:jar:1.1:provided
[DEBUG]       javax.xml.soap:saaj-api:jar:1.3.4:provided
[DEBUG]       org.glassfish:javax.annotation:jar:3.1.1:provided
[DEBUG]       javax.jws:jsr181-api:jar:1.0-MR1:provided

so terribly sorry but I don't think I'll be getting this into jetty eclipse anytime soon... I dropped the ball on this and should have investigated much deeper on the dependencies originally.  If there is interest we could get it into jetty codehaus but it would be better to have someone willing to maintain it there so let me know if there is interest in that.

cheers,
jesse
Comment 5 Jesse McConnell CLA 2012-12-14 16:36:55 EST
we have dropped the SPI bits from jetty-9 and this was difficult to mesh into the existing http spi so it never made it in, sorry about that but thank you for the contribution!